Abstract
High and low resolution spectra of the spectroscopic triple star θ Muscae were studied for time-variability. Within 7 min no variations were found in the low resolution data. On a time scale of 8 days and longer, variations in the P Cygni profiles of the resonance lines occur. These may be explained as variable mass loss from the system, or as aspect effects in an asymmetric wind flow.
